Game Recap: Women's Lacrosse |

No. 7 Queens Tops Saint Leo

CHARLOTTE, N.C. – The Queen's University of Charlotte women's lacrosse team, ranked seventh in the nation, collected its second-straight victory today topping Saint Leo, 14-7. Queens improves to 2-1 on the season, while the Lions fall to 1-1 on the season.
 
The Royals were led by Kelly Dowd who totaled four goals and one assist. Alexandra Bruder also netted four goals, while Alison Conn, Abigail Paulus, Hanna Scott, Katy Miller, Katy Pawlikowski, and Sydney Lear each finished with one goal apiece. Scott led in assists with three, while Taylor Quade added two assists. 
 
Queens took over the game early with a goal by Scott in the first 46 seconds of the opening half. A few minutes later, Queens scored two-consecutive goals, forcing the Lions to call a timeout. Saint Leo rallied to put their first shot in the back of the net but Queens ended the half on a 4-1 run. Both Dowd and Bruder claimed a hat-trick before the half concluded as the Royals broke with an 8-2 score.
 
Saint Leo opened the second half with two straight scores from both Sabrina Sanacore and Kaylah Walstad. However, the Royals respond with a pair of goals from Bruder and Paulus to make the lead 10-4 with 21:28 remaining.
 
After a goal put in the back of the net by the Lions' Lexie Walstad at the 19:10 mark created a back-and-forth affair, the Royals matched with goals from Dowd, Pawlikowski, and Miller to bring the lead to 13-7. Each team would exchange goals one more time in the final three minutes, as the Royals held on for the 14-8 victory.
 
Saint Leo was led by Katherine Larson's three goals, while Kaylah Walstad totaled one goal and one assist in the loss.
 
Queens won the battle in shots on goal 31-13, ground balls 23-15, and draw controls 16-7. Chase Brokaw of Queens finished the game with the win after totaling five saves.  
 
The Royals can be seen back in action on Thursday, March 2 as they open South Atlantic Conference play against Catawba College. The game is set to begin at 4 p.m.
